What is Xenical?
Xenical is the trademark name for the pharmaceutical drug Orlistat, a potent lipase inhibitor. Unlike lots of other weight-loss medications that act as appetite suppressants by affecting the central worried system, Xenical works in your area within the gastrointestinal system. It is created for people with a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 30 or higher, or those with a BMI of 27 or greater who also experience weight-related conditions such as type 2 diabetes or hypertension.

The Mechanism of Action: How It Works
The human body utilizes enzymes called lipases to break down dietary fats into smaller sized elements that can be taken in through the digestive wall. When Xenical is ingested, it attaches itself to these enzymes, avoiding them from operating properly.
When the lipases are prevented, approximately one-quarter to one-third of the fat consumed in a meal stays undigested. Due to the fact that this fat is not broken down, the body can not absorb it for energy or shop it as fat (body fat). Legal Status and Availability in Germany
In Germany, the pharmaceutical market is strictly regulated by the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M). Xenical (120mg Orlistat) is classified as a prescription-only medication. This indicates it can only be lawfully gotten through a pharmacy (Apotheke) after presenting a valid prescription from a certified doctor.
Why is a Prescription Necessary?
A doctor needs to assess the client's health history to ensure that Xenical is a safe and suitable choice. Specific hidden conditions or potential drug interactions make expert medical oversight vital.
Alternatives for Acquisition
- Regional Pharmacies: Any stationary drug store in Germany can provide Xenical if a prescription is provided.
- Registered Online Pharmacies: Patients can use certified German online drug stores (Versandapotheken). To do this, the physical prescription should normally be sent by mail to the pharmacy, or an electronic prescription (E-Rezept) should be published.
- Telemedicine Services: Some licensed European telehealth platforms enable patients to go through a digital consultation. If the doctor considers the treatment appropriate, they release a prescription that is satisfied by a partner pharmacy and shipped to Germany.

Dosage and Administration Guidelines
To achieve optimal results and lessen side effects, Xenical must be taken properly. The following standards are basic practice for the administration of this medication:
- Frequency: One 120 mg capsule is normally taken 3 times a day.
- Timing: The capsule ought to be swallowed with water either right away previously, throughout, or approximately one hour after each main meal.
- Fat Content: The medication only works in the presence of dietary fat. If a meal is avoided or consists of no fat, the dosage for that meal need to be omitted.
- Consistency: The medication should belong to a nutritionally well balanced, calorie-reduced diet plan where around 30% of calories originated from fat.
Possible Side Effects and Precautions
Since Xenical changes the method the body procedures fat, many adverse effects are intestinal in nature. They are typically described as "treatment results" since they are straight connected to the intake of high-fat foods while on the medication.
Common Gastrointestinal Side Effects:
- Oily identifying on undergarments.
- Flatulence with discharge.
- Urgent requirement to have a defecation.
- Oily or fatty stools.
- Increased frequency of defecation.
Keep in mind: These side results are generally momentary and can be significantly lowered by strictly sticking to a low-fat diet.
Who Should Avoid Xenical?
Xenical is not ideal for everyone. It is contraindicated in the following cases:
- Pregnant or breastfeeding females.
- People with persistent malabsorption syndrome.
- People with cholestasis (a liver condition).
- Individuals with recognized allergies to Orlistat or any of the non-active ingredients.
The Importance of a Balanced Diet
Xenical is not a "magic tablet" that permits for unlimited eating. It is a tool to enhance the impacts of a healthy lifestyle. In Germany, nutritional therapists typically suggest the following dietary changes when taking Orlistat:
- Distribute Fat Evenly: Daily fat consumption must be spread out across 3 primary meals to prevent a localized "overload" of undigested fat in the intestines.
- Vitamin Supplementation: Because Xenical hinders the absorption of some fat-soluble vitamins (A, D, E, and K), a multivitamin is typically suggested. This ought to be taken at least 2 hours before or after taking Xenical (generally at bedtime) to ensure absorption.
- Hydration: Maintaining adequate water intake is crucial for general gastrointestinal health.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Just how much weight can I anticipate to lose with Xenical?
Medical research studies reveal that many individuals lose 5% to 10% of their body weight within six months to a year, supplied they follow a calorie-reduced diet and exercise plan.
2. Is Xenical covered by German health insurance (Krankenkasse)?
For the most part, weight-loss medications are classified as "way of life drugs" in Germany and are not covered by statutory health insurance coverage (Gesetzliche Krankenkasse). However, clients with severe comorbidities must consult their supplier, as exceptions are sometimes made.
3. Can I consume alcohol while taking Xenical?
While there is no direct chemical interaction in between alcohol and Xenical, alcohol is high in "empty" calories and can hinder weight-loss objectives. Moderation is advised.
4. The length of time can I take Xenical?
Treatment is typically continued as long as the client is dropping weight. If a patient has not lost a minimum of 5% of their preliminary body weight after 12 weeks of treatment, a physician may advise ceasing the medication.
5. Can I take Xenical if I am on other medications?
Orlistat can engage with specific drugs, such as blood thinners (Warfarin), levothyroxine (for thyroid), and some anti-epileptic medications. It is necessary to divulge all present medications to a doctor before beginning Xenical.
